About

A Funicular Operator is responsible for controlling and monitoring the operation of funicular railways, ensuring passenger safety and adherence to schedules. This role involves operating the control systems, performing routine safety checks, and responding promptly to any operational issues. The operator must maintain clear communication with the control center and comply with all safety regulations and protocols.

Tasks

  • Operate the funicular railway according to established schedules and safety procedures.
  • Monitor control panels and mechanical systems during operation.
  • Perform pre-operation safety inspections and routine maintenance checks.
  • Communicate effectively with the control center and other team members.
  • Respond promptly to emergencies or operational disruptions.
  • Ensure passenger safety and provide assistance when needed.
  • Maintain accurate logs of operations and incidents.
  • Adhere strictly to safety regulations and company policies.
  • Participate in ongoing training and certification programs.
  • Report any technical issues or safety concerns immediately.
